Swiftshader Dx9 Sm3 Build 3383zip Best _top_ -

SwiftShader DX9 SM3 Build 3383 is a specialized software renderer that allows computers without a dedicated graphics card to run older 3D games by emulating DirectX 9.0 features, specifically Shader Model 3.0 (SM3) , using the CPU. Key Features & Usage

: It acts as a drop-in replacement for GPU drivers, enabling games to run entirely on the CPU. Shader Model 3.0

: This specific build is highly sought after because it supports SM3, which is required by many titles from the mid-2000s that won't launch on older integrated graphics (like Intel 9xx series). Installation : To use it, you typically copy the

file from the ZIP archive and paste it into the same directory as your game's executable ( Configuration : After running the game once with the DLL present, a swiftshader.ini

file is usually generated. You can edit this file to tweak settings like pixel and vertex shader versions to balance performance and visual accuracy. Performance Considerations CPU Intensity

: Emulating a GPU is extremely taxing on the processor. For the best experience, a multi-core CPU is recommended to handle both the game logic and the SwiftShader rendering. Compatibility Issues

: While it can get games to start, some titles may only display cutscenes or experience black screens if the shaders aren't perfectly compatible with the software emulation.

: While much faster than standard Microsoft reference rasterizers, it still performs significantly slower than even low-end dedicated hardware. Google Groups Where to Find It

While originally a commercial product by TransGaming, SwiftShader became open-source under Google. Community-archived versions like Build 3383 are often found on enthusiast forums and repositories: SwiftShader DX9 SM3 Build 3383.rar - Facebook

I couldn’t find any verified or safe source for a file named exactly “swiftshader dx9 sm3 build 3383.zip”.

Here’s what you should know before searching for it:

Recommended safe alternative:

If you need SM3.0 emulation for an old game, try dgVoodoo2 or WineD3D for Windows – both are safer and better documented.

Here’s a professional report format:


Configuration (Optional)

You can tweak performance by opening the SwiftShader.ini file with Notepad. You can adjust settings like:

B. Virtual Machine Gamers

Running Windows XP or 7 in VMware or VirtualBox? The virtual GPU often lacks full DX9 SM3 acceleration. SwiftShader 3383 allows you to play older 3D games inside a VM with acceptable framerates (15-30 FPS on a modern host CPU).

Common Use Cases

⚠️ Important Notes:

Let me know if this works for your specific game!


Tags: #SwiftShader #DX9 #SoftwareRenderer #LegacyGaming #Build3383 #ShaderModel3

In a world where technology had advanced beyond recognition, a small group of developers had been working tirelessly to create a new graphics rendering engine. Their goal was to push the boundaries of what was possible on even the most modest of hardware. swiftshader dx9 sm3 build 3383zip best

The team, led by a brilliant and eccentric individual known only by their handle "SwiftShader," had been pouring their hearts and souls into the project for months. They had encountered countless setbacks and challenges along the way, but their determination and passion had driven them forward.

As the project neared completion, the team began to discuss the final details. They were working on a DirectX 9 implementation, specifically targeting Shader Model 3.0. The goal was to create a fast, efficient, and highly compatible rendering engine that could breathe new life into older hardware.

One team member, a quiet and reserved individual known as "DX9 Guru," had been instrumental in optimizing the code for maximum performance. They had spent countless hours tweaking and fine-tuning the engine, ensuring that it could handle even the most demanding games and applications.

As the team worked, they began to refer to their project by a codename: "SM3 Build 3383." It was a name that would become synonymous with speed, efficiency, and compatibility.

Finally, the day arrived when the team was ready to release their creation to the world. They packaged the engine into a convenient zip file, aptly named "swiftshader dx9 sm3 build 3383.zip." As they shared it with the community, the response was overwhelming.

Users marveled at the engine's performance, which was often comparable to or even surpassing that of more modern graphics cards. The compatibility was astonishing, with even the most demanding games and applications running smoothly.

The team behind SwiftShader had achieved something truly remarkable. Their dedication and expertise had resulted in a graphics rendering engine that would go on to breathe new life into countless systems, allowing gamers and developers alike to experience the thrill of modern graphics on even the most vintage of hardware.

As the years went by, SwiftShader's creation would become a legendary component in the world of retro gaming and development, with many regarding it as one of the greatest achievements in the field of graphics rendering. And at the heart of it all was the team of passionate developers, led by the enigmatic SwiftShader, who had dared to dream big and push the boundaries of what was thought possible.

SwiftShader DX9 SM3 Build 3383 is a specific, vintage version of TransGaming's (now Google's) software-based 3D renderer

. It is primarily used to bypass hardware limitations on older PCs or virtual machines by emulating Shader Model 3.0 (SM3) and DirectX 9 on the CPU. Google Groups

The Legacy of Software Rendering: An Essay on SwiftShader Build 3383 Introduction

In the history of PC gaming, few tools have achieved the cult status of SwiftShader, particularly the DX9 SM3 Build 3383. Released at a time when rapid advancements in Shader Model requirements often outpaced the hardware budgets of casual users, SwiftShader served as a bridge between the possible and the impossible. While dedicated Graphics Processing Units (GPUs) became the standard for 3D rendering, software-based solutions like SwiftShader offered a lifeline for those operating on integrated chipsets or legacy systems. SourceForge The Technological Shift Build 3383 was a milestone because it brought Shader Model 3.0

capabilities to systems that physically lacked the hardware for it. By translating Direct3D 9 commands into instructions that a central processor could understand, it allowed games like Street Fighter 4

to launch on hardware that would otherwise trigger a "pixel shader not supported" error. However, this feat came with a significant performance cost. Since the CPU was forced to handle tasks typically reserved for thousands of specialized GPU cores, frame rates were often relegated to a "playable" but sluggish crawl, often requiring users to tweak configuration files to lower shader versions just to gain a few frames per second. Impact and Evolution

The significance of Build 3383 lies in its democratic approach to technology. It turned the CPU into a versatile fallback, making it an essential diagnostic and development tool for the industry. Developers used it to test 3D applications in environments without GPUs, such as servers or early virtualized desktops. Over time, Google acquired TransGaming’s SwiftShader technology, evolving it into a high-performance open-source project that now supports Vulkan and OpenGL ES, serving as a critical component in the Chrome browser to ensure WebGL content can run even on "deny-listed" or unstable GPUs. Google Groups Conclusion

While SwiftShader DX9 SM3 Build 3383 may now be a relic of the Windows XP and early Windows 7 era, it remains a testament to the ingenuity of software engineering. It reminds us that software can often overcome hardware limitations, providing a digital safety net that keeps older applications alive and ensures that modern web graphics remain accessible to everyone, regardless of their hardware specs. Download link For SwiftShader DX9 SM3 Build 3383

SwiftShader DX9 SM3 Build 3383 is a high-performance CPU-based software rasterizer used to run games or applications that require DirectX 9 and Shader Model 3.0 on hardware without a compatible dedicated GPU. It is commonly used for testing or running older titles on integrated graphics that lack native SM3 support. Key Technical Aspects Software Rendering:

Offloads graphics processing to the CPU. Because it emulates hardware functions, performance is heavily dependent on CPU clock speed and core count. Shader Model 3.0 Support: SwiftShader DX9 SM3 Build 3383 is a specialized

Build 3383 allows software that strictly requires Pixel Shader 3.0 or Vertex Shader 3.0 to bypass hardware checks. Configuration: Users often modify the and an accompanying

configuration file to toggle features like resolution scaling or to force specific shader versions to improve stability. Google Groups Performance & Usage Notes

While SwiftShader is one of the most efficient software renderers, it is generally considered a "last resort" for gaming. CPU Overhead:

Using SM3 capabilities in this build significantly increases CPU usage compared to older SM2.0 versions. Compatibility:

It is frequently cited in communities for Intel 9x graphics chips (like the GMA 950) to bridge the gap for games like Street Fighter IV Resident Evil 5 Stability: Misconfiguring the shader model in the

file can lead to black screens or crashes if the application's visual assets cannot be correctly translated by the CPU. Google Groups Best Practices for Setup Placement:

file directly into the same folder as the game's executable ( Configuration: SwiftShader.ini file to adjust the PixelShaderVersion VertexShaderVersion for SM3 support. Optimization:

Disable heavy post-processing effects in-game (like Anti-Aliasing or Motion Blur) to reduce the computational load on your processor. or finding the latest open-source alternatives like Google's current SwiftShader project? Download link For SwiftShader DX9 SM3 Build 3383

SwiftShader is a high-performance software-based 3D renderer that emulates graphics hardware on your CPU. The specific "DX9 SM3 Build 3383" version was historically popular for users with integrated graphics (like Intel GMA 9xx) to run games requiring DirectX 9 and Shader Model 3.0. What is SwiftShader DX9 SM3 Build 3383?

Purpose: It acts as a drop-in replacement for graphics drivers by providing a software-based d3d9.dll file. This allows games to run even if the physical GPU doesn't support the required shader versions.

Shader Model 3 (SM3): This build specifically targets compatibility for Shader Model 3.0, which was a common requirement for mid-to-late 2000s games like Street Fighter 4 or Hitman: Blood Money.

Performance Trade-off: Since it uses the CPU for all graphics calculations, performance is typically much slower than a physical GPU. It is often used for diagnostics or as a last-resort fallback for older or GPU-less systems. How to Use It

Drop-in Replacement: On Windows, you typically place the SwiftShader DLL files (d3d9.dll) directly into the same folder as the game's executable (.exe).

Configuration: Some builds include a SwiftShader.ini file that allows you to manually set the Pixel and Vertex shader versions (e.g., setting them to 1.1 or 2.0 to potentially increase FPS in less demanding games). Current Status and Safety

SwiftShader DX9 SM3 Build 3383 is a highly regarded version of the software-based 3D renderer that enables computers without a dedicated graphics card to run older DirectX 9 games. By executing graphics commands on the CPU rather than the GPU, it acts as a "bridge" for legacy systems or low-end hardware that lacks hardware-level support for Shader Model 3.0 (SM3). Key Features & Performance

DirectX 9 & SM3 Support: Specifically designed to handle APIs like Direct3D 9, allowing for advanced lighting and shading effects that would otherwise require a compatible GPU.

CPU-Based Rendering: It leverages multi-core processors and SSE instructions to simulate a graphics accelerator, making it useful for virtualization or testing environments.

Optimization Options: In this build, users can often tweak configuration files to lower pixel and vertex shader versions (e.g., to version 1.1) to increase FPS on slower CPUs. Recommended safe alternative:

Drop-in Compatibility: The renderer typically functions as a DLL file (e.g., d3d9.dll) that you simply place in the same folder as a game's executable to redirect API calls to the software engine. Why "Build 3383" is Preferred

Among the community of users with legacy hardware (such as Intel 9xx graphics users), Build 3383 is often cited for its stability and specific ability to handle SM3-only games like Street Fighter IV or Hitman: Blood Money on machines that natively support only SM2.0. However, because it relies entirely on the CPU, running SM3 games will significantly increase processor usage compared to earlier versions. Where to Find It

While the original commercial product was developed by Transgaming, it is now an open-source project maintained by Google. You can find various archived and community builds on:

SourceForge SwiftShader Mirror: Host for various versions, including source code.

GitHub (pal1000/swiftshader-dist-win): Provides pre-compiled binaries for modern Windows environments.

Legacy Forums: Sites like VOGONS or specific Google Groups dedicated to old hardware often host specific builds like 3383. Download link For SwiftShader DX9 SM3 Build 3383

SwiftShader DX9 SM3 Build 3383: The Software Powerhouse for CPU-Based Rendering

SwiftShader is a high-performance, software-based 3D graphics rendering engine developed by Google. Its primary goal is to provide hardware independence for advanced graphics APIs like DirectX 9 and OpenGL. By executing graphics commands entirely on the CPU, it allows modern applications and games to run on systems that lack a dedicated graphics card or possess an outdated integrated GPU.

Among its various iterations, the SwiftShader DX9 SM3 Build 3383 stands out as a highly sought-after build for users needing Shader Model 3.0 (SM3) capabilities on older or specialized hardware. Core Features of Build 3383

This specific build is often packaged as a ZIP file containing the necessary DLLs to bypass hardware limitations. Key features include:

DirectX 9.0 Support: Implements the DirectX 9.0 API, including critical features like stenciling and floating-point rendering.

Shader Model 3.0 (SM3): Provides the pixel and vertex shader capabilities required by many mid-2000s games (e.g., Street Fighter 4, Hitman 4) that would otherwise fail to launch on older Intel integrated graphics.

Dynamic Compilation: Uses just-in-time (JIT) compilation to transform 3D rendering needs into highly optimized machine code for x86 CPUs.

Multi-threading & SSE Support: Leverages SSE extensions and multi-core processors to achieve performance that can surpass basic 2D or low-end integrated graphics. Why Use Build 3383?

While newer versions of SwiftShader focus on the Vulkan API, Build 3383 remains a "best" choice for legacy gaming and specific emulation tasks: Download link For SwiftShader DX9 SM3 Build 3383

6. Compatibility Notes

Part 8: Legal & Safety Note

SwiftShader was originally open-sourced by Google (Apache 2.0 license). However, many sites repackage it with keyloggers. Always verify the file signature or compile from source if you are paranoid. Never download from "free game boosters" or "FPS unlockers" pop-up ads.

The authentic Build 3383 ZIP should contain only two .dll files and a LICENSE.txt text file. If you see an .exe installer or a .bat script, delete it immediately.